    What Causes Twins?
    The number of twins is on the increase, probably because of IVF treatment where more than one fertilised egg is placed in the womb.

    Of the non-IVF twins, there are two causes:

    1. Two eggs are released during ovulation and both are fertilised by separate sperm - it is possible twins can be fathered by two different Dads! In this case the twins are not identical (even if they have the same Dad!). Non-identical twins are also known as fraternal, they s ...

    Oligonucleotide analogues

    The present invention relates to novel bicyclic and tricyclic nucleoside and nucleotide analogues as well as to oligonucleotides comprising such elements. The nucleotide analogues, LNAs (Locked Nucleoside Analogues), are able to provide valuable improvements to oligonucleotides with respect to affinity and specificity towards complementary RNA and DNA oligomers.
